My mum has been diagnosed with stage 4 stomach cancer this week and the hospital have asked for the family to attend an appointment next week. I’m unwell myself with a neurological disorder and stress triggers seizures & symptom's. I know they have not been honest with me and are only telling me the bare minimum. Can you tell me what this meeting will be for?? Is this the norm?? I just want to be prepared before I go so I know what to expect. Thank you for your help in advance.

  • Hello Shoola and thanks for your post,

    I am sorry to hear about your situation and can understand what a difficult time this must be for you and your family. 

    It is difficult to know what they are going to say about your mum without being involved in her care and I would hate to second guess what they are going to say.

    It can be helpful to have all the family present particularly if they are finding out what support there is at home if they are talking about treatment or future plans for your mum. It can also help to have all the family present so everyone is put in the picture at the same time.

    If you are concerned about your own health it maybe better if another member of your family can go in your place and then any conversation that does take place can be relayed to you after the consultation.
